Dean Devlin

Recently added

Bad Samaritan
6.5

Bad Samaritan

Apr. 19, 2018

Bad Samaritan

A pair of burglars stumble upon a woman being held captive in a home they intended to rob.
Geostorm
5.3

Geostorm

Oct. 13, 2017

Geostorm

After an unprecedented series of natural disasters threatened the planet, the world’s leaders came together to create an intricate network ...